Northrop Grumman Mission Systems (NGMS) is seeking a Sr. Staff ASIC Physical Design Engineer to support our growing engineering team in advanced technology development programs based out of Annapolis Junction, MD.
Roles and Responsibilities:
Responsible for the complete physical implementation at both block and chip levels.
Perform physical design of ASIC designs, including floor planning, placement and routing, clock tree synthesis, physical verification, and IR/EM analysis.
Ensure the final physical implementation meets all design requirements.
Lead team of ASIC engineers to meet design requirements and the schedule.
Collaborate with the front-end team to address and resolve design issues and challenges.
Develop automation and flow enhancements to improve processes and implementation efficiencies.
Report ASIC physical design status to the project leadership.
Basic Qualifications:
Bachelor's degree with 14 years of experience, a Master's degree with 12 years of experience or a PhD with 9 years of experience in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, Computer Science, or related technical fields; an additional 4 years of experience may be considered in lieu of a degree.
U.S Citizenship is required
The ability to obtain/maintain an Active DoD secret clearance
Experience in full product life cycle of ASIC Design
Proficient in backend ASIC design including synthesis and static timing analysis, place and route, physical verification (LVS/DRC)
Proficient with Cadence and Siemens ASIC toolset e.g., Innovus, Genus, Tempus, Calibre, etc.
Has working knowledge in HDL (VHDL/Verilog)
Proficient in scripting languages such as Tcl, Python or Perl
Knowledge of DFT, including scan insertion and ATP
Effective communication and presentation skills and high proficiency in technical problem solving
